In the summer, every kitchen faces two "problems". One is the preservation of bananas and the other is homemade ice cream. Bananas are sensitive to high temperatures, and they are not good for storing in the refrigerator. So many times we end with black, damaged bananas that end up in the trash. On the other hand, ice cream, the most popular summer dessert, can be a nuisance for any kitchen: ready-made ice cream is expensive and full of calories, while homemade requires special equipment and time. The solution to both problems comes from the banana ice cream!
The use of ripe bananas (which would otherwise end up in the trash) as raw material for frozen desserts is quite old and has its roots in America. The bananas are first frozen and then beaten in the blender with ingredients that will enhance their texture, such as honey or praline, while a host of other ingredients, such as peanut butter, syrup or dried nuts can be used to enhance the flavor. In our version, we use a double espresso, which gives intensity and sweet and savory aromas to our sweet, making it look like a delicious gelato moka!
